Web22 feb. 2024 · People who are Black and Latino often identify as Afro-Latino, while other Black people of Latin American descent forego the Latino/Hispanic labels altogether. … Web26 aug. 2015 · But in Brazil you would be preto (black), while your lighter sibling would be considered pardo (brown, not black). Sounds strange if you’re from the States. But among Brazilians of African and European descent, color determines race in Brazil more than it does in America.
